Transaction ef77f3f8b2d22b94ed83d1098a94498fa61d2c94911003ba9341fa8926089432
1 Input
1 Output
-
ef77f3f8b2d22b94ed83d1098a94498fa61d2c94911003ba9341fa8926089432:0
- value
- 696289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f334beeacc58b6523fc6dcdb1ba4616e7e09a79 OP_EQUAL
- address
- 335PWa98xndBJXLqvyJj93xNMabBeuUX4h